## Sensor drift: what to do at 3am

If the GrowLoop controller starts reporting humidity swings that don't match the backup probes in the Fernwick greenhouse, it's almost always sensor drift, not an actual climate event. Don't panic and don't touch the vents manually. First, restart the calibration daemon and give it ten minutes to re-baseline. If readings still disagree by more than 5%, flip the controller into safe mode. The safe-mode thresholds it will use are these.

config for yahap-bajof:
[istix]
host = istix.qorvelsys.internal
user = istix_svc
database = istix_prod

Subject: Checkout load tests — before your first shift

Welcome aboard. Before the weekly eng sync, please review how we load test the Fernbasket checkout flow: tests run only against the shadow environment, never production, and require a booked window. Thresholds, ramp profiles, and abort criteria are documented on the internal page below.

wiki page, bawef-hafop: https://jira.nelvroworks.corp/job/pages/projects/7c5c0f440dbd

Action item from the Gridlock incident: the Wordenmill crossword generator hung on sparse dictionaries because backtracking had no depth cap, stalling the nightly puzzle publish for two days. Fix adds hard limits on backtrack depth, candidate fanout, and total solver time, with a fallback to the previous day's grid on timeout. Release manager: these limits ship as build-time constants, not config, so bumping them requires a new release. Ship with the values below and do not override.

tuning constants:
TIERS = {
    "sorion": 670,
    "istax": 547,
}

The locked case contains eight Pellcroft T2 prototype handsets, inventoried and sealed at the Marnell Works annex. The case must remain latched for the full route; the driver carries no key. Keep the case in the cab, not the cargo bed, and avoid temperatures above 35°C. Confirm departure and arrival times with your desk by radio, not text. Any seal damage must be reported before the vehicle leaves the receiving yard. The courier's confidential hand-over instruction is appended directly below this line.

courier memo of fahag-badug: the norys istion courier leaves the zoriel ledger at gate 4000 under passcode 457370